Step-by-step formatting workflow

Step 1

Clean the Word source

Resolve pasted styles, inconsistent spacing, and manual layout before upload.

Step 2

Mark chapters consistently

Use predictable chapter starts and headings so navigation is easier to review.

Step 3

Remove page-based elements

Running headers, page numbers, and fixed page design do not belong in most reflowable Nook files.

Step 4

Preview the converted book

Review chapter navigation, front matter, images, and spacing in the platform preview.

Common formatting mistakes

  • Leaving print-book page numbers in the e-book source.
  • Using manual spacing to force chapter starts.
  • Relying on visual styling instead of consistent Word styles.
  • Publishing without checking the converted Nook preview.

Does B&N Press need a print-ready PDF for Nook e-books?

No. Reflowable Nook e-books are not print PDFs. Prepare a clean source file and preview the converted e-book output.

Does B&N Press accept DOCX files?

Yes, B&N Press accepts DOCX files which are automatically converted to EPUB format for Nook devices.

How are chapters created in B&N Press?

Insert a Section Break (Next Page) at the beginning of each chapter. B&N Press creates chapter headings from these section breaks.

What is the file size limit for B&N Press?

E-book files must be under 20MB. Print book files can be up to 650MB.

Can I use superscripts and subscripts?

B&N Press recommends avoiding superscripts, subscripts, and auto-formatted fractions as they may not convert correctly.
